It's kind of silly to me that many fans and those in the media are hoping for us to lose in the last couple weeks because 1)our draft position will be lower than if we miss the playoffs and 2)that our schedule will be tougher next year due to having to play division winners as opposed to 2nd/3rd place finishers.

Well, first of all, do we really want to have a pick in the 7-11 range AGAIN. Granted, we would probably get a good player, but the draft is just as much of a crap shoot in the top half of the first round as it is in the bottom half. Had we had the 21st pick in the 2010 draft (and that is what we would have next year at the highest if we made the playoffs) we could have gotten a player like B. Bulaga, D. Bryant, D. McCourty, K. Wilson, J. Best or P. Robinson. I don't think any of us would have been upset with any of those guys on our team. Point is, play for this year and getting a high draft pick (unless we could be in the A. Luck sweepstakes...which we won't be) should not play a part in wanting to get a win.

As for the schedule, we have to play the NFC East next year. That means by winning our division we would likely play CHI and ATL next year. Big deal. Does it really matter if we play those two or if we play NO and GB. Actually, I think we would match up better with the likely division winners than the 2nd place teams.

Bottom line, any fan and knowledgeable media person should understand this. If your a fan, root for your team and cut the loser talk so we can have a high draft pick and easier schedule.
